Check alle échte Black Friday-deals Ook zo moe van nepaanbiedingen? Wij laten alleen échte deals zien
Toon posts:

Browser screendump naar database / file

Pagina: 1
Acties:

Verwijderd

Topicstarter
Hallo,

Ik zit met de volgende situatie. Ik draai een open source firmware (DD wrt) op mijn Linksys WRT54GL. Nu zit er een tool in deze firmware die de opgeving scant op de aanwezigheid van wireless adapters. Van deze adapters geeft hij de RSSI aan. Ik wil graag deze informatie dumpen naar een database of bestand (real-time). De tool biedt echter geen export mogelijkheden. Is het mogelijk om de weergave in een browser (IE, FF, Chrome, maakt niet uit) te dumpen naar een database / bestand ?

  • Osxy
  • Registratie: Januari 2005
  • Laatst online: 28-11 21:40

Osxy

Holy crap on a cracker

Ik denk dat je met een combinatie van lynx/curl en grep een heel eind komt.

"Divine Shields and Hearthstones do not make a hero heroic."


Verwijderd

Topicstarter
Dat gaat alleen werken onder UNIX/LINUX of niet? Ik ben daar namelijk niet zo bekend mee dus prefereer een windows oplossing.

  • burne
  • Registratie: Maart 2000
  • Niet online

burne

Mine! Waah!

Verwijderd schreef op zaterdag 11 april 2009 @ 16:31:
Dat gaat alleen werken onder UNIX/LINUX of niet? Ik ben daar namelijk niet zo bekend mee dus prefereer een windows oplossing.
Als je denkt dat screenshot's OCR'en en daar de data uit vissen een snellere oplossing is...

lynx/links, curl, grep en nog veel meer tooltjes kun je probleemloos gratis installeren: click

De rest is een leuke les in progammeren.

I don't like facts. They have a liberal bias.


  • Fatamorgana
  • Registratie: Augustus 2001
  • Laatst online: 21-07 01:24

Fatamorgana

Fietsen is gezond.

Misschien kun je hier iets mee?
http://nl.php.net/manual/en/function.imagegrabscreen.php

Dan heb je het wel alleen als plaatje natuurlijk.

[ Voor 22% gewijzigd door Fatamorgana op 11-04-2009 16:36 ]


Verwijderd

Topicstarter
Ik heb het nu geprobeerd met Lynx, maar die kan de betreffende pagina niet interpreteren. Het is namelijk content die iedere seconde opnieuw gegenereerd wordt. Als ik in FF de gewone paginabron bekijk zie ik de gegenereerde tekst ook niet. Ik moet de gegenereerde DOM bron opvragen om dit te kunnen zien. Die bron wil graag iedere seconde oid in een database dumpen. Iemand enig idee?

Verwijderd

Is het niet interessanter om aan de slag te gaan met tools specifiek om dit soort dingen te meten dan het jezelf ingewikkeld te maken met screengrabbing etc. ? Ik weet natuurlijk niet wat je einddoel is maar met bvb http://wifihopper.com of http://netstumbler.com/ kan je ook RSSI waarden meten / exporteren ...

Verwijderd

Verwijderd schreef op zaterdag 11 april 2009 @ 15:42:
Hallo,

Ik zit met de volgende situatie. Ik draai een open source firmware (DD wrt) op mijn Linksys WRT54GL. Nu zit er een tool in deze firmware die de opgeving scant op de aanwezigheid van wireless adapters. Van deze adapters geeft hij de RSSI aan. Ik wil graag deze informatie dumpen naar een database of bestand (real-time). De tool biedt echter geen export mogelijkheden. Is het mogelijk om de weergave in een browser (IE, FF, Chrome, maakt niet uit) te dumpen naar een database / bestand ?
Als het apparaat (x)html genereert waarom doe je dan geen rechtstreekse http requests vanuit uit je code en parse je de html die het ding terugstuurt om daar de voor jou relevante code uit te halen en die informatie op te slaan.

Verwijderd

Topicstarter
Het einddoel is een soort WiFi positioneringssysteem. Op basis van RSSI wordt er een locatie berekend. Wat ik dus nodig heb ik is een RSSI van mobiel apparaat vanuit een aantal routers. De software moet dus op de router draaien om de juiste RSSI te genereren.

Wat betreft die http-requests. Het is denk ik wel mogelijk op die manier, alleen heb ik 1 probleem. Het geheel draait vanuit een javascript. Je moet eerst op een plaatje klikken (javascript link) voordat de RSSI gegenereerd wordt. Kan ik dit oplossen met http requests?

  • leuk_he
  • Registratie: Augustus 2000
  • Laatst online: 28-11 09:35

leuk_he

1. Controleer de kabel!

Verwijderd schreef op zaterdag 11 april 2009 @ 15:42:
Hallo,

Ik draai een open source firmware (DD wrt) op mijn Linksys WRT54GL.
Lijkt me een kwestie van die source aanpassen zodat hij doet wat je wilt. Mocht je daar niet handig mee zijn dan kun je met een wget de html pagaina overhalen en die met je favoriete tool parsen en inerten in je database.

Als je met een https spy (b.v addon in mozilla Tamper data) kijkt wat hij verstuurd als je op dat plaatje klikt zal het wel loslopen.

[ Voor 17% gewijzigd door leuk_he op 12-04-2009 10:59 ]

Need more data. We want your specs. Ik ben ook maar dom. anders: forum, ff reggen, ff topic maken
En als je een oplossing hebt gevonden laat het ook ujb ff in dit topic horen.

Pagina: 1